  16. Posted May 27, 2007 at 19:57 | Permalink

    Allright I found a cause and a solution.

    The wrong size was caused by imported picture which was about 1300 x 600…

    Here it becomes weird. I traced the picture inside flash and deleted it from library, erasing background (white) from the traced picture and resizing it to 560 x 400. (It was because I wanted to make a transparent map of the world appearing in lightbox style, but learned that it wasn’t possible with lightbox v2 for now)

    Although original picture was not present , when I pressed match: content in modfy > document it showed me the original picture’s dimentions ! It would seem that flash remembers the last (biggest) dimmension of imported picture, and flashbox reads it. As I got a reply to my problem (thanks :) it get’s probably too technical for me. I’ll pass.

    I pasted the library to a new file and it works ok. I strongly recommend using pictures with background though as it can mismatch the size again.

    Or you can always use a background with alpha=0 it also works well.

  22. Posted November 16, 2007 at 01:19 | Permalink

    Hi Steve,
    thx for using FlashBox, and thx for taking the time to comment on it.

    Lets get those questions answered:
    1. I have noticed this also but only very recently … I was working on a page where I use sifr to generate titles and was using FlashBox. The same thing happened: FlashBox went underneath the other flash objects.

    The only solution to this problem is to add wmode=transparant to the flash objects other then FlashBox:
    read more about that here: http://kb.adobe.com/selfservice/viewContent.do?externalId=tn_14201&sliceId=1

    To edit an existing HTML page, add the WMODE parameters to the HTML code.

    1. Add the following parameter to the OBJECT tag:

    2. Add the following parameter to the EMBED tag:
    wmode="transparent"
